Wildlife Center of Virginia is a Non Profit organization based in United States, with around 50 employees and annual revenues of $5.0 million.
Wildlife Center of Virginia oper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as Drupal Commerce, Intuit Mailchimp and Amazon SES, covering areas like eCommerce, Marketing Automation and Transactional Email.
Wildlife Center of Virginia has invested in cloud applications and AI-driven platforms to optimize efficiency and growth, collaborating with vendors such as Drupal, Intuit and Amazon Web Services (AWS).
Wildlife Center of Virginia recently adopted applications including Intuit Mailchimp in 2025, Google Tag Manager in 2025 and Amazon SES in 2025, highlighting its ongoing modernization strategy.
